Related: Editorials & Other Articles, Issue Forums, Alliance Forums, Region ForumsMarsha Blackburn, Diane Black Offer Dueling Bills To Defund Planned Parenthood
?7House Republicans are so eager to strip federal family planning funds from Planned Parenthood that two of them have introduced identical bills to do so in the first days of the new Congress.
Tennessee Reps. Marsha Blackburn (R) and Diane Black (R) separately reintroduced a bill during the first two days of the 2013 legislative session that would prohibit Title X family planning grants from being awarded to any organization that performs abortions. The bill, first introduced by former Rep. Mike Pence (R-Ind.) in the 112th Congress, primarily targets Planned Parenthood, which receives about $340 million a year in Title X funds for non-abortion health and family planning services. Both bills amend Pence's original bill to include exceptions for rape, incest and to protect the life of the mother.
Blackburn is Vice Chair of the House Energy and Commerce Committee, the committee with jurisdiction over the issue. Since she filed and circulated her bill on Thursday, the first day of the legislative session, more than a half-dozen Republicans have signed on as cosponsors and numerous anti-abortion groups have endorsed it.
Blackburn declared the bill a priority for her committee and vowed to carry on Pence's agenda. Congressman Pence has been a champion in the fight to protect innocent human life and I hope to continue his leadership in the House, she said in a statement. "As a woman, I believe America deserves better than abortion."
